Transaction 5beecda580639174f46c16b2936367d9541ac83bff35b92f238da9591c12de47
1 Input
1 Output
-
5beecda580639174f46c16b2936367d9541ac83bff35b92f238da9591c12de47:0
- value
- 99597
- script pubkey
- OP_0 OP_PUSHBYTES_20 05c368c47de76719ac84d224f353090b6a42b8fb
- address
- bc1qqhpk33rauan3ntyy6gj0x5cfpd4y9w8myqd50s